Transaction 32554890f6d74c3d8aa61165852a0abc731572f40aa495d7a6f9c6bb97ff36d6
1 Input
1 Output
-
32554890f6d74c3d8aa61165852a0abc731572f40aa495d7a6f9c6bb97ff36d6:0
- value
- 50176
- script pubkey
- OP_0 OP_PUSHBYTES_20 821d20a18b40b76805b30646915c4a6c566e42cb
- address
- bc1qsgwjpgvtgzmkspdnqerfzhz2d3txusktqs55qd